About the Role

A General Manager must be committed to inspiring the team, helping customers succeed, and growing the business with integrity. This professional-level sales and management position supports both retail and professional customer functions. The role requires understanding of store systems, automotive systems, parts knowledge, and the ability to troubleshoot and assist DIY customers. It is an exempt position requiring a minimum of 50-55 hours per week, with schedules based on business needs.

Schedule

The average schedule is 5-6 days per week, with 11-hour shifts including rotating nights and weekends. An hour is provided for lunch. Additional hours may be required based on staffing, store conditions, sales targets, and other business demands.

Responsibilities

  • Achieve overall store sales goals and service objectives.
  • Manage and grow professional customer relationships and sales, including building and holding the team accountable to executing customer action plans.
  • Oversee selection, hiring, development, performance management, coaching, scheduling, and engagement of store team members.
  • Ensure execution of all inventory and operational standards.
  • Coach all team members to deliver on customer expectations (DIY and professional).
  • Handle manager-on-duty responsibilities, including touch base/coaching, floor/phone management, task assignment and completion, safety, and open/close duties.
  • Lead change management initiatives.
  • Foster a respectful environment for both customers and team members through diversity and inclusion.
  • Provide DIY services such as battery installation, testing, and wiper installation.
  • Assist with district/region functions as requested.

Physical Demands

The role predominantly involves walking or standing. The employee must be able to talk, hear, and use hands and fingers to handle or feel; reach with hands and arms; climb or balance; and stoop, kneel, crouch, or crawl. The employee must frequently lift and/or move up to 50 pounds and occasionally lift and/or move up to 100 pounds. Specific vision abilities required include close vision, distance vision, color vision, depth perception, and the ability to adjust focus.

Work Environment

The work environment is primarily indoors, but occasional outdoor tasks (e.g., installing batteries and wiper blades) expose the employee to various weather conditions. The employee may also be exposed to moving mechanical parts, high or precarious places, toxic or caustic chemicals, risk of electrical shock, explosives, and vibration. The noise level is usually moderate.
